After playing around with the Elite Dangerous Voicepack ASTRA I decided I wanted to create one for Freespace 2
For those not familiar with this here is some information:
Voice Attack is a voice recognition program that is used for many games and sims. It has the ability to play back sound files when a command is given. It also can detect keyboard and joystick commands as well. You can assign multiple VR commands as well as multiple random sound responses.
HSC Elite Dangerous Voicepack is a professionally recorded voice with a huge database of responses.

https://youtu.be/sEnAACFHyNEhttps://www.youtube.com/watch?v=J19D0T9-V_YWell some good news. It seems that the Freespace 2 Voice Recognition and VoiceAttack programs can work at the same time. This is great as the built in one handles the COMMS in a way that VoiceAttack could never do as it knows what ships and wings are in a given mission. I was greatly relieved after I tested it out. Another thing that I found out is that by running VoiceAttack as an admin I was able to get it to respond to Xpadder key presses. This will allow me to have voice or sound feedback from any of the buttons on my panels.
I created the voice response files using an application that allowed me to create mp3 files from a list of commands from a text file. I also used Audacity to record and save some of the technical database within the game. After all the computer assistant should have that information in her database. Still need to finish all the other commands but the basic structure is in place and most of the voice responses have been created.
